About Check Point Software Technologies Ltd

Check Point is a global leader in cybersecurity solutions. It provides comprehensive protection against advanced cyber threats for corporate networks, cloud environments, mobile devices, and critical infrastructure.

About iShares MSCI Australia ETF

EWA tracks the MSCI Australia Index, providing broad exposure to large and mid-cap companies in the Australian equity market. It is structurally dominated by the financial and materials sectors, serving as a key instrument for investors seeking a single-country view of Australia's resource-rich and stable economy.
